Pros
Key benefits and features.
Unlimited complimentary domestic & international airport lounge access for primary cardholder.
Get up to 4 free golf rounds/lessons monthly, based on your previous month's retail spends.
Attractive 'Buy One Get One' movie/event ticket offers via BookMyShow and dining discounts.
Comprehensive travel insurance, including ₹3 Crore air accident cover & cancellation waivers.
Choose between annual/monthly plans with spend-based fee waivers for financial flexibility.
Pros
Key benefits and features.
Generous welcome benefit of 40,000 Reward Points (equivalent to ₹10,000).
Attractive milestone benefits offer premium brand vouchers like Tata CLiQ Luxury, Taj, and Apple.
Exclusive complimentary memberships to Club Marriott, WSJ, Mint, and the Angel Investor Network (IPV).
Extensive travel benefits with unlimited international and domestic lounge access, plus spa access.
Comprehensive insurance coverage for travel, accidental death, and fraud protection.
Pros
Key benefits and features.
Provides significant welcome benefits worth Rs. 5,000, offsetting the first-year annual fee.
Generous complimentary lounge access: 2 domestic/quarter, 6 international/year via Priority Pass.
Accelerated rewards on dining, groceries, and departmental store spends.
Versatile credit card with privileges across diverse categories, ideal for luxury lifestyle & travel.
The annual fee can be waived upon achieving an annual spend milestone of Rs. 10 lakhs.
Cons
Key drawbacks and limitations.
Significant joining and annual fees, though waivable with high annual spending thresholds.
Very high-income criteria restrict access, making this card exclusive to high earners.
A charge of ₹99 + GST is applied for every request to redeem reward points.
Concierge services are restricted to major metropolitan cities in India only.
Discrepancies exist in reported foreign currency markup and interest rates across sources.
Cons
Key drawbacks and limitations.
A 1% standard reward rate is basic for a super-premium card with such a high annual fee.
Discontinuation of valuable prior subscriptions like Amazon Prime, Zomato Gold, and Discovery Plus.
Being an invite-only card significantly limits its accessibility, even for eligible high-income applicants.
Cons
Key drawbacks and limitations.
Base reward rate of 0.5% on general expenditures is low compared to rival premium cards.
High annual fee of Rs. 4,999 may be a disadvantage if waiver criteria aren't met or benefits underutilized.
Specific benefits like golf or dining offers are often limited to certain card variants.
